Node JS developer
Orangetheory Fitness
Contract Boca Raton , Florida, United States Posted 4 years ago
About Position
Node JS developer (Contract)
$55.00 / Hourly
Boca Raton , Florida, United States
Node JS developer
Contract Boca Raton , Florida, United States Posted 4 years ago
Description
Top 3 Skills 1) Node.js 5+ years; if someone is an overall excellent engineer with less than 5 years of Node.js, they will consider
2) .NET 3) Problemsolving skills/engineering skills; manager is looking for someone who doesn't just develop all day but looks at the big picture and is strategic with how they go about things
SUMMARY
The Node JS developer role will be responsible for implementing and developing full stack platforms, APIs and complete user interface in the form of a mobile and desktop web applications, with a focus on performance. ESSENTIAL JOB FUNCTIONS Develop highly interactive web applications utilizing JavaScript, HTML5, CSS, JSON, ReactJS, and integrating Restful APIs, external web services ensuring high performance on Mobile and Desktop. Translate functional/nonfunctional requirements into systems requirements validating user actions on the client side and providing responsive feedback.
Meet with project stakeholders discuss their vision, ideas and create compelling digital experiences. Translate design patterns into application architectures.
Create custom general use modules and components extending the elements and modules of core ReactJS.
Write clean modular, reusable code in ES6
Familiar with transpilers such as Babel
Write front end use cases using above tech stack to meet critical business requirements. Resolve existing front end issues owning assignments and see thru completion and execution. Test Angular JS applications via Jasmine, protractor.
Collaborate with Onsiteoffshore development teams and provide clear concise directions on solutions delivery that can be reusable, testable and efficient code.
Lead and aid web app development team in continuing to add features in creating innovative solutions.
Conceptualize, design and develop user interface designs in a fastpaced online/mobile environment. Consumer applications as well as enterprise platforms Collaborate with stakeholders within a multidisciplinary team to gather design requirements and translate those requirements into highquality visual solutions.
Understand UI/UX best practices and drive improvements in designs and methodology.
Collaborate closely with business stakeholders, product owners and development leads.
Ability to interpret and apply client branding/corporate identity guidelines onto new and existing Orangetheory applications and transactional (ecommerce/Mobile/consumer) websites.
REQUIRED EDUCATION/EXPERIENCE/SKILLS
Bachelors Degree in Information Technology, Computer Science or equivalent work experience Minimum 5 years of related work experience in technology A minimum of 3 years commercial experience in a node JS developer role NodeJS and Front End technologies with full stack development.
Experience with ReactJS
Experience with Express for creating RESTFUL backend APIs
Experience testing ReactJS web applications using Mocha and related technologies Ability to execute implementations based on architecture briefs creating by Solution architect
Familiar with web sockets, and implementing push based services
4 years of experience with strong proficiency with Javascript, Node.JS and related frameworks with a good understanding of server side, accessibility and security compliance
Strong knowledge of integrating multiple sources following fundamental design principles for a scalable application. Experience in creating configuration build and test scripts for continuous integration in Gulp or Grunt
Proficient understanding code versioning tools such as GIT Repository
Expertise with HTML5 including CSS3, browser APIs and canvas
Experience in consuming Restful APIs. Expert knowledge and experience with JSON / XML / RESTful Web Services and services integration with ReactJS mobile responsive apps
Experience in documenting the code and writing unit test cases
Experienced with NodeJS Development methodologies
Experience building web applications for mobile devices.
By applying to a job using PingJob.com you are agreeing to comply with and be subject to the PingJob.com Terms and Conditions for use of our website. To use our website, you must agree with the Terms and Conditions and both meet and comply with their provisions.